How to replace window rollers

This is a DIY deal. I bought the rollers and pins from classic chevy. I installed one using there new pin. I did not like how it mushroomed over. Thus I ground it off and used the OEM pins and the new rollers. I ground down the staked side and , used a square face punch. I installed the new roller , tapped the new set up back into the arm and hit it very quicly with the mig. Then used a bit of water to cool the part down to prevent the roller from melting. It took me less than 10 minutes to do all them this way. Just thought it would be a nice post.
